Nintendo Direct Partner Showcase Announced for February 5th

As rumored in previous weeks, Nintendo will host a Direct Partner Showcase on February 5th. Airing at 6 AM PST, it will run for about 30 minutes and offer new details on upcoming Nintendo Switch 1 and 2 games.

Being a Partner Showcase means that the focus is predominantly on third-party offerings. It’s a pretty wide net, but given Bloober Team’s recent countdown website, we wouldn’t be surprised if its next project (potentially the Switch 2-exclusive Project M) received its first trailer.

While the next generation of Pokémon won’t appear, we’ll likely see Pokémon Pokopia, the life sim from Omega Force. After all, AAA Studio showcased Hyrule Warriors: Age of Imprisonment at the July 2025 Partner Showcase. Sure, it’s not quite third-party, but the keyword in this case is “Partner.”

Capcom may also make an appearance, potentially announcing a release date for the Switch 2 demo of Pragmata and dropping a new trailer for Monster Hunter Stories 3: Twisted Reflection (launching on March 13th). However, this may finally mark the announcement of Monster Hunter Wilds for the Switch 2, especially after datamining allegedly unearthed its frame rate, resolution, and more.

Either way, it should provide a closer look at Nintendo’s release schedule for the coming months, so stay tuned for more details and live coverage.
